Geological context: Late Cretaceous, Carlile Sh, Turner Sandy Mbr. Collection locality: 90.5-98.5 feet above base of Turner, 2 mi W of US Rt 85, & 8 mi NNW of Belle Fourche, Butte County, South Dakota, USA. Collected by Karl M. Waage, Neil H. Landman, 1977.
